“Albanian Book Festival” in Toronto
The Artistè Foundation Supports the Success of the Albanian Book Fair Through Volunteerism

TORONTO - The second edition of “Libri Shqip - Albanian Book Festival” in Toronto once again brought together hundreds of participants, authors, artists, and supporters of Albanian culture, turning the event into one of the most important cultural gatherings for the Albanian diaspora in Canada.

An important contribution to the smooth organization and success of the fair came from The Artistè Foundation, whose volunteer team actively supported the event throughout the two-day program. With dedication, energy, and professionalism, members of the foundation assisted with coordination, guest reception, and logistical support, helping create a welcoming and organized atmosphere for attendees.


Community representatives highly appreciated the engagement of the young volunteers from The Artistè Foundation, emphasizing the important role that younger generations play in preserving and promoting Albanian culture and identity abroad. Their participation was seen as a positive example of community collaboration and cultural commitment.

 



The “Libri Shqip” Book Fair, organized by Albanian Canadian Development Alternative (ACDA), featured a rich program including book presentations, cultural discussions, artistic performances, and meetings with well-known Albanian and Albanian Canadian authors.

 

The contribution of The Artistè Foundation once again highlighted the importance of Albanian youth and artistic organizations in strengthening cultural ties within the diaspora and preserving the Albanian language and heritage for future generations.
